Output 08fae17bc84cfe4f3a8feba2c2073a10a4e4da970db7399bc315a55ab7d9850a:10

value
99626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f7909631a9fdc40df19c429d229ba7a3b7c0e5 OP_EQUAL
address
39LzaZxFwzz5vB3b3FEvsMzbChBDK4igc7
transaction
08fae17bc84cfe4f3a8feba2c2073a10a4e4da970db7399bc315a55ab7d9850a
confirmations
287963
spent
true